STATEMENT OF MAYOR MICHAEL R. BLOOMBERG ON DEATH OF HAROLD B. JACKSON

“Today, we mourn the passing of Hal Jackson, a radio pioneer and a member of the Radio Hall of Fame whose voice broke through color lines and broke down racial barriers for countless Americans. Hal was not only the first African-American voice on network radio or the first African-American play-by-play sports announcer, but an iconic legend who – during the Civil Rights movement – gave voice to the many who simply did not have one. When Hal moved to New York, he continued to lead the way at 107.5 WBLS for so many African-American radio announcers who followed. On behalf of a grateful city, our sincerest condolences and prayers are with his family at this time.”
